
一、什么是网络嗅探?
网络嗅探,顾名思义,就是通过特定的工具或软件,对网络传输的数据进行实时监测和捕获的技术手段。它能够帮助我们了解网络中的数据传输情况,发现潜在的安全风险,提高网络安全防护能力。
二、网络嗅探的原理与应用
- 原理
网络嗅探的原理是基于对网络数据包的捕获和分析。网络数据包是计算机网络中传输数据的基本单位,每个数据包都包含了源地址、目的地址、数据类型等信息。网络嗅探工具通过监听网络接口,捕获经过的数据包,然后对数据包进行分析,提取有用的信息。
- 应用
(1)网络安全检测
网络嗅探可以帮助我们发现网络中的异常流量,如恶意攻击、数据泄露等。通过对数据包的分析,我们可以识别出攻击者的IP地址、攻击类型、攻击目标等信息,从而采取相应的安全措施。
(2)网络性能优化
网络嗅探可以监测网络中的数据传输情况,分析网络拥堵的原因,帮助我们找出网络瓶颈,优化网络配置,提高网络性能。
(3)网络流量监控
网络嗅探可以实时监控网络流量,了解用户上网行为,为网络运营商提供有价值的参考数据。
三、网络嗅探工具与技巧
- 工具
目前,市面上有很多网络嗅探工具,如Wireshark、TCPdump等。这些工具功能强大,操作简单,适合不同水平的用户使用。
- 技巧
(1)选择合适的网络接口
在进行网络嗅探时,我们需要选择合适的网络接口。通常情况下,选择“Any”或“Monitor mode”即可。
(2)筛选数据包
网络嗅探工具会捕获大量的数据包,我们可以通过筛选功能,只**我们感兴趣的数据包。
(3)分析数据包
对捕获的数据包进行分析,提取有用的信息。我们可以**数据包的源地址、目的地址、数据类型、传输协议等。
四、网络嗅探的法律法规
在我国,网络嗅探属于一项敏感技术,未经授权擅自进行网络嗅探是违法的。因此,我们在使用网络嗅探工具时,务必遵守相关法律法规。
Q:网络嗅探是否会对个人隐私造成侵犯?
A:网络嗅探可能会侵犯个人隐私。在使用网络嗅探工具时,我们需要确保自己的行为符合法律法规,不得侵犯他人隐私。
Q:网络嗅探是否会对网络性能造成影响?
A:网络嗅探本身不会对网络性能造成影响。但过度的网络嗅探可能会导致网络拥堵,影响网络性能。
Q:网络嗅探能否用于非法目的?
A:网络嗅探技术本身是中性的,既可以用于合法目的,也可以被用于非法目的。我们在使用网络嗅探工具时,必须遵守法律法规,不得用于非法目的。